The Awed Child

If you want to take using props to the next level, the photo below is an excellent example of what you can do with them.

Grace with Christmas Lights

Grace with Christmas Lights

This amazing photo combines a number of different photographic elements in order to create a truly unforgettable photo.  The black background, for example, helps make the pale skin of the child and the bright colors of the ornament, the lights and the hat stand out.  In addition, the Christmas lights surrounding the child create an interesting glow on the child’s naked skin.  Of course, the nudity of the child helps add to the innocence of the child, while the fact that the child is looking down in apparent wonderment at the ornament helps to express the feelings of awe that so many of us feel at this time of the year.
